What is a Pacification Campaign?

A pacification campaign
is a military operation to control, conquer and settle in a given inhabited region.
In this case:
The Portuguese Empire, in the late 19th century consisting in a few ports along the east and west African coast, emparked in a plan to accompany its european counterparts in the scramble for Africa and led ferocious pacification campaigns into the interior of Angola and Mozambique.
The Cuamato peoples offered legendary resistance for its bravery, intelligence and nobility having fought four battles until completely defeated and colonized.
